Web Developer Resume
Ithaca, NY
PROFESSIONAL EXPERIENCE
Confidential, Ithaca, NY
Web Developer
Responsibilities:
- PHP/Drupal 7 development, extended HybridAuth Drupal module to support Linkedin OAuth 2.0 protocol, authored custom provider adapter
Programmer/Analyst
Confidential
Responsibilities:
- Data collection for various clients, preparation of email reminders, data file deliverables, etc. Analyze data collected for integrity.
Android Developer
Confidential
Responsibilities:
- Develop eBird bird monitoring Android application.
Confidential
Responsibilities:
- Built an inventory - tracking application for a midsize logistics company. Rails 5, MySQL, Heroku, Git
- Configured a survey research application for a policy research institute, created a marketing website for a municipality
Confidential, New York, NY
TEMPPrincipal Software Engineer
Responsibilities:
- Platform development for mobile devices. PostgreSQL, Rails 3.x development on Heroku, Git version control. TDD: RSpec. Async jobs: Sidekiq (Redis-based). Agile development methodology. Employment limited by interruptions in company funding.
Confidential, San Francisco, CA
Software Engineer
Responsibilities:
- MySQL, Rails 3.1 .x development, on Passenger on EC2, Git version control. TDD: RSpec/Capybara/FactoryGirl. Async jobs: Sidekiq (Redis-based). UI: Confidential Bootstrap/jQuery. Autantication: Devise, OmniAuth. Agile development methodology.
Confidential, Palo Alto, CA
Founder/CTO
Responsibilities:
- PostgreSQL, Rails 3.1.x, Heroku, Unicorn, Git. UI: Confidential Bootstrap/jQuery. Gems: sorcery, declarative authorization, RSpec (TDD), capybara, factory girl, sidekiq.
Confidential, Palo Alto, CA
Senior Software Engineer
Responsibilities:
- MongoDB, MongoMapper, Rails 3.x, Agile.
Confidential, Palo Alto, CA
Lead Software Engineer
Responsibilities:
- Asynchronous REST API for messaging/email for a Python client app using MongoDB, Rails 3.x, Heroku, Resque. Agile/TDD.
Confidential, Palo Alto, CA
Founder/CTO
Responsibilities:
- Built a scheduled publishing/e-commerce platform for local deals and events in Ruby on Rails from scratch.
- Heavy use of Confidential APIs and Resque gem for asynchronous, scheduled syndication to Confidential (19K local followers) and Confidential (7K local app users + 4K likes). ActiveMerchant/Authorize.net e-commerce.
- Email subscriber base of 32K, web traffic 60K local unique monthly visitors. Production software stack includes Ubuntu Linux, MySQL, Phusion Passenger, nginx and Redis.
Confidential, Palo Alto, CA
Software Engineer
Responsibilities:
- Rails/MySQL development on crunchbase.com (top 50 Rails site), maintained Confidential, #1 WordPress site in teh world.
Confidential, New York, NY
Software/Systems Engineer
Responsibilities:
- Deputy CTO, maintenance/development of JSP-based end-to-end recruiting platform and internal bulk email system. Debug, maintain and extend existing legacy HTML/JSP/JDBC/SQL codebase.
- Migrated from Windows 2K Advanced Server/Oracle/Tomcat/JDBC/JSP/Ant on SATA hard drives to Fedora Core Linux/PostgreSQL/Tomcat/iBATIS/Spring/Struts2/JSP/Maven on SSD drives.
Confidential, Santa Monica, CA
Software Development Intern
Responsibilities:
- Java SE, Java Swing, bash scripting, DB2 experience working on Symantec Security Information Manager production code.